Science & Geo : Layers of the earths atmosphere

Troposphere :

  • lowest atmosphere

  • where weather accures

  • extends out to 4-10 miles

  • tempreture decreases with increase of altitude

  • (altitude means height of object / how far it is from the ground)

stratosphere :

  • 2nd lowest layer of the atmosphere

  • the temperature rises with the increase of altitude

  • u will find the ozone layer here

  • (the ozone layer helps absorb the harmful UV rays from the sun)

  • is free of all weather disturbances

  • extends to about 30-35 miles above the earths surface

mesosphere :

  • where most meteors burn when entering

  • stretches up to 50 miles above earths surface

  • the meteors make it through the exosphere and thermosphere bc those layers dont have much air but there are enough gases to cause friction and create heat

thermosphere :

  • air is very thin here

  • temp gets extremely hot here

  • extends up to 400 miles above the earths surface

  • the lower part of this surface contains the ionosphere

  • the ions in the ionosphere help to transmit radio waves

  • many atoms are ionized there

  • you can also find electrical charge in the ionosphere

  • The temperature of the thermosphere increases with height due to absorption of solar radiation within the ionosphere

  • ions are atoms that contain an uneven number of protons and electrons which result in an overall positive and negative charge

  • Ions in the ionosphere help transmit radio waves that where transmitted from the earth

  • High Frequency (HF) radio waves hitting the free electrons in the ionosphere cause them to vibrate and re-radiate the energy back down at the same frequency

exosphere :

  • last layer

  • air is quite thin

  • goes al the way up to 6200 miles above the earths surface
